THIS year marks a more meaningful Merdeka Day celebration, says Seri Delima assemblyman Syerleena Abdul Rashid.

A Merderka Day and Malaysia Day celebration at the neighbourhood of Taman Tun Sardon on Sept 8 saw some 300 children dressed in the Jalur Gemilang costume and traditional wear while marching as a gesture of celebrating our independence.

It was also joined by JKKK Bukit Gelugor, JKKK Island Glades, JKKK Sungai Gelugor and Rukun Tetangga of the Seri Delima constituency.

Syerleena, who launched the celebration, was also seen joining the children to march from Dewan JKKK Bukit Gelugor to Taman Tun Sardon food court and then marched back towards the starting point.

The marching which started on a breezy Saturday morning at 7am ended around 10am and sprinkled the vibe of Merdeka Day and Malaysia Day in the air as well as capturing the attention of onlookers.

The children then exhibited their talents by reciting poems, singing and dancing patriotically at the Dewan JKKK Bukit Gelugor.

Syeerleena, during her speech at the event, said that this year the National Day is more special and meaningful as there is now cohesion between the state and federal governments after Pakatan Harapan captured Putrajaya and can work together for the benefit of fellow Penangites.

The northeast district Cohesion Officer (Pegawai Perpaduan daerah timur laut) Othman Saad said that more community programmes will be held at the Rukuntetangga (12 Rukuntetangga) of the Seri Delima constituency by the ‘Jabatan Perpaduan Negara dan Integrasi Nasional’.

Also present at the celebration was Bukit Gelugor MP Ramkarpal Singh.
